It is crucial to understand the legal implications of using such tools. The primary purpose of the VAG EEPROM Programmer is for legitimate automotive repair, maintenance, and diagnostics. However, it can be used for nefarious purposes, such as odometer fraud. Deliberately rolling back a car's mileage for resale is illegal in most countries and is considered a serious act of fraud. Always use these powerful diagnostic tools ethically and responsibly, adhering to all local laws.

Connect your KKL/K+CAN cable to the OBD2 port and the computer. Turn the ignition to ON (or Pos II). Open the software and select the correct COM port. Choose the cluster type (e.g., VW VDO, Audi VDO). Click (Decrypted).
